探索MAXQ1050:深度安全保障的USB微控制器
在电子设计领域,安全与性能始终是工程师们关注的核心。今天,我们就来深入探讨Maxim Integrated的MAXQ1050——一款具备USB接口和硬件加密功能的DeepCover安全微控制器。
文件下载:MAXQ1050.pdf
一、总体概述
MAXQ1050专为USB安全令牌和智能卡读卡器应用而设计,这些应用通常需要基于证书或其他公钥加密方案。它采用DeepCover™嵌入式安全解决方案,通过多层先进物理安全机制保护敏感数据,实现尽可能安全的密钥存储。
当检测到攻击条件时,该设备内置的复杂安全机制会发挥作用,两个自毁输入和环境监测器(温度和电压传感器)会擦除密钥数据。此外,它集成了全速USB设备接口(包括收发器)、硬件SPI控制器以及用于智能卡通信的ISO 7816 UART。同时,还支持通过硬件加速器对AES、RSA、DSA、ECDSA、SHA - 1、SHA - 224、SHA - 256、DES和3DES进行高速加密,并配备了真正的硬件随机数生成器用于密钥生成和挑战生成。
二、应用领域
| MAXQ1050的应用范围广泛,涵盖了安全与银行、智能电网安全等多个领域: | 安全与银行 | 智能电网安全 |
|---|---|---|
| 令牌 | 预付费公用事业 | |
| 证书管理 | 电子商务 | |
| 电子签名生成 | 安全访问控制 | |
| 按次付费 |
这些应用场景充分体现了MAXQ1050在保障数据安全和提供可靠加密服务方面的价值。
三、产品特性
高性能低功耗的32位MAXQ30 RISC内核
- 电源与时钟:可由USB供电或使用单3.3V电源,运行于典型20MHz内部振荡器,也支持外部12/24MHz晶体振荡器用于微控制器和USB操作,片上还有2x/4x时钟乘法器。
- 指令与数据处理:采用16位指令字和32位内部数据总线,拥有16个32位累加器和16个32位通用工作寄存器。
- I/O接口:多达20个通用I/O引脚,具备5V容忍I/O能力,软件栈几乎无限制,且针对C编译器进行了优化,能生成高速、高密度代码。
丰富的内存配置
- 闪存:128KB闪存,每页512 x 32,每个扇区支持20k次擦除/写入循环。
- SRAM:包括12KB SRAM、4KB电池备份非易失性SRAM和256B电池备份安全非易失性SRAM,其中256B的内存可在不到1Fs内通过单脉冲快速清零,即使在电池备份模式下也能实现。此外,还有1.5KB的易失性加密内存可作为通用数据内存使用。
强大的安全特性
- 唯一标识:拥有唯一的64位序列号。
- 防篡改:具备篡改检测功能,可快速销毁密钥和数据,在检测到篡改事件时会销毁密钥,还有永久加载器锁定选项。
- 加密加速:采用专有的随机密钥代码加扰技术,配备用于AES、RSA、DSA、ECDSA、DES、3DES、SHA - 1、SHA - 224、SHA - 256的硬件加速器。
- 随机数生成:内置真正的硬件随机数生成器。
- 环境监测:温度和电压传感器可检测攻击,还有两个自毁输入引脚。
多样的外设功能
- 电源管理:具备电源故障警告、上电复位/欠压复位功能。
- 通信接口:全速USB设备,带有六个端点缓冲区和集成收发器;ISO 7816智能卡UART带有FIFO;SPI主/从硬件。
- 定时器与计数器:16位可编程定时器/计数器,具备预分频器、捕获/比较和PWM功能。
- 看门狗定时器:可编程看门狗定时器。
- I/O与中断:多达20个通用I/O引脚,带有八个外部中断。
四、开发与技术支持
相关文档
为了充分利用MAXQ1050的所有功能,设计人员需要以下文档:
- 数据手册:包含引脚描述、功能概述和电气规格。
- 勘误表:记录与公布规格的偏差。
- 用户指南:从编程角度详细描述设备功能和外设。
开发工具
Maxim和第三方供应商为该微控制器提供了多种价格合理、功能多样的开发工具,如编译器、在线仿真器、集成开发环境(IDEs)以及用于编程和调试的JTAG - 串口转换器等。部分开发工具供应商信息可在www.maximintegrated.com/MAXQ_tools查询。
技术支持
若需要技术支持,可访问https://support.maximintegrated.com/micro 。
五、订购信息
| 型号 | 温度范围 | 闪存程序内存(KB) | 数据内存 | 引脚封装 |
|---|---|---|---|---|
| MAXQ1050 - BNS+ | -40°C至 +85°C | 128 | 256B快速擦除NV SRAM、4KB NV SRAM、12KB SRAM | 40 TQFN - EP* |
| MAXQ1050 - DNS+ | -40°C至 +85°C | 128 | 256B快速擦除NV SRAM、4KB NV SRAM、12KB SRAM | 裸片 |
注:“+”表示无铅/符合RoHS标准的封装,*EP = 外露焊盘。
对于最新的封装外形信息和焊盘图案,可访问www.maximintegrated.com/packages 。
MAXQ1050以其卓越的安全性能、丰富的功能和良好的开发支持,为电子工程师在设计安全相关应用时提供了一个可靠的选择。你在实际设计中是否会考虑使用这款微控制器呢?它又能为你的项目带来哪些独特的优势?欢迎在评论区分享你的想法。
-
安全保障
+关注
关注
0文章
5浏览量
6106 -
MAXQ1050
+关注
关注
1文章
5浏览量
8213
发布评论请先 登录
MAXQ1850:为数据安全保驾护航的嵌入式微控制器
探秘MAXQ1103:深度安全防护的微控制器解决方案
探索 MAXQ1741:用于磁卡读取的深度安全微控制器
探索AT43USB355:适用于游戏控制器的高性能USB微控制器
深度剖析 MAXQ3212 微控制器:设计与应用的全面指南
探索MAXQ610:低功耗16位微控制器的卓越性能与应用潜力
探索MAXQ3210微控制器:低功耗高性能的理想之选
MAXQ3108低功耗双核微控制器:设计与应用全解析
探索MAXQ613:16位红外模块微控制器的卓越性能
探索MAXQ305:低电压红外模块微控制器的卓越性能
探索Cypress EZ - USB FX2LP:高性能USB微控制器的深度剖析
MAXQ1741用于磁卡读卡器的DeepCover安全微控制器技术手册
探索MAXQ1050:深度安全保障的USB微控制器
评论